If R is wife of A, then how is A related to V? Study the following information carefully and answer the questions given below: S is the nephew of V who is the only brother-in-law of T. T has no siblings. X is the mother of W who is the father of S. Y who has only two children, and is the spouse of X. U is the mother of R who is the grandchild of Y.

Four of the following five options share a specific common characteristic and thus form a group. Which of them does not belong to that group?

Solution :

The correct option is T.

Let us analyze the family relations and derive the gender of each person step-by-step from the given information:

1. Relationships of V and T: V is the only brother-in-law of T, and T has no siblings. Since T has no siblings, T cannot have a sibling whose spouse is V. Therefore, T must be married to V's sibling. This means V is male and is the brother of T's spouse.
2. Relationships of X, Y, W, and S: X is the mother of W, so X is female. W is the father of S, so W is male and S is male (nephew). Y is the spouse of X, making Y male. Y has only two children. Since S is the nephew of V and W is the father of S, V must be W's brother. Thus, the two children of X and Y are W (male) and V (male).
3. Gender of T: Since W is V's brother and T is married to V's brother, W and T are married. Because W is male, T must be female.
4. Relationships of U, R, and A: U is the mother of R, who is the grandchild of Y. This makes U the wife of V (female), and R their daughter (female). R is married to A, which makes A male (husband of R).

Now, let us determine the gender of each person listed in the options:

T: Female
Y: Male
W: Male
V: Male
S: Male

Four of the five options (Y, W, V, and S) are males and share the common characteristic of being male. T is female and therefore does not belong to the group.
